An Artist and Producer from London, born into a lineage of vicars and church leaders, Henry drifted from the constraints of the church to wrestle with faith and God out in the open, finding reflections of his songs in the works of Sufjan Stevens, Bob Dylan, Young Fathers and Low. His imagination is illuminated by Rainer Maria Rilke’s poetry, the cinematic surrealism of David Lynch, Philip Ridley’s myriad avenues of storytelling, the unsettling grace of Flannery O’Connor, and the intricate narratives of Donna Tartt Coke, as his music oscillates between desolation, distortion, beauty, and rage.
